British Airways operations resumption to improve country’s image: FPCCI.

The Federation of Pakistan Chambers of Commerce and Industry (FPCCI) said resumption of British Airways operations for Pakistan is a breakthrough which will improve the country’s image.

In a statement, FPCCI Vice President Karim Aziz Malik said international community is recognizing Pakistan’s potential as a new and good investment destination.

Applauding the services of special assistant to Prime Minister on overseas Pakistanis Sayed Zulfikar Abbas Bukhari, he said that the credit of British Airways’ return to Pakistan goes to Sayed Zulfikar Abbas Bukhari.

He also lauded the steps taken by Zulfikar Abbas Bukhari to boost remittances, which is the lifeline for the national economy, as overseas Pakistanis are sending over 20 billion dollars through the proper channel.
